By this application, the applicant seeks pre-arrest bail in connection with C.R. no.I-39 of 2015, registered with the Vishnu Nagar Police Station, Thane, for the alleged offences punishable under Sections 376, 506 of the Indian Penal Code.
3.
Admittedly, the complainant and the applicant were previously married, before they met each other. Both have children from their
2/3 previous marriages. The complainant is alleged to have separated from her husband, about two years prior to meeting the applicant. Sometime in December, 2012, the applicant's and complainant's friendship developed into a love affair. Thereafter, it is alleged that the applicant on the pretext of marriage had sexual relations with the complainant. It is alleged that the applicant told the complainant, that he would divorce his wife and thereafter marry the complainant. According to the prosecutrix, the applicant had given false promise of marriage and from December 2014, he suddenly cut off relations with her.
4.
Learned Counsel for the Applicant states that it is a case of consensual sex and that both the parties were aware that they were married. Without going into the merits, as to whether the consent was obtained, on the promise of marriage or not, considering the peculiar facts of the case, the applicant deserves to be granted pre-arrest bail, on the following terms and conditions :
ORDER
i) In the event of the arrest, the Applicant be enlarged on bail on furnishing P.R. Bond in the sum of Rs.15,000/- with one or two sureties in
3/3 the like amount ;
ii) The Applicant shall attend the Vishnu Nagar Police Station, Thane, on every Sunday, between 11.00 a.m to 12.00 noon, till the filing of the charge-sheet;
iii) The Applicant shall not tamper or attempt to influence the complainant or any persons concerned with the case.
5.
The Application is allowed and disposed of in above terms. 6.
